Описание книги
Одним из видов деятельности коммерческого банка является выдача кредитов. Заявок на получение кредита в банк может поступать очень много. Они обрабатываются в специальных отделах и оцениваются на возможность заемщика выполнить свои обязательства. Так как банк выделяет ограниченное количество денежных средств на выдачу кредитов и устанавливает рамки допустимых потерь от предполагаемого дохода, то некоторое количество заявок необходимо отклонять. Встает вопрос, каким образом сформировать список одобренных заявок, чтобы получить как можно больший доход и соблюсти вышеописанные ограничения. В данной работе рассматривается эта задача. Так как она имеет большую размерность, предложено использовать модифицированный генетический алгоритм для ее решения. Модификации подверглись оператор формирования начальной популяции и оператор формирования нового поколения. Начальная популяция генерируется не случайным образом, а по определенному алгоритму в допустимых рамках. А при формировании нового поколения оно пополняется индивидами из массива лучших решений в случае, если происходит стагнация алгоритма. Было разработано программное обеспечение, использующее данный алгоритм для решения поставленной задачи. Работа алгоритма была исследована и выявлено, при каких значениях параметров алгоритма он показывает лучшие результаты.